CVE-2025-53187 is a critical authentication bypass vulnerability affecting all versions of ABB Cylon ASPECT Building Management Systems prior to 3.08.04-s01. This flaw stems from debug code inadvertently left in the market release, allowing unauthenticated attackers to manipulate system time, access files, and execute functions. With a CVSS score of 9.8 (CRITICAL), it presents a high risk due to its network-based attack vector, low complexity, and complete compromise of confidentiality, integrity, and availability. While there is no known active exploitation or public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), the vulnerability has garnered significant community discussion, indicating high awareness.
